Christian Dior Couture — Paris: Men's Studio Assistant (internship). Six-month full-time role supporting the Artistic Director's studio and show logistics.
Role & Responsibilities
- Assist the Artistic Director’s personal assistant with daily administrative duties and confidential tasks.
- Manage order entry and follow-up using Dior Order; draft and maintain administrative forms.
- Coordinate logistics for the Artistic Direction and liaise with the studio coordination team, particularly during show periods.
- Order and distribute look books for each collection and monitor related stock (e.g., masks, candles).
- Organise and follow-up on time-sensitive deliveries and courier services (Top Chrono, DHL and internal couriers).
- Coordinate Artistic Director’s requirements and supervise the assembly and layout of spaces for runways and presentations.
- Prepare and maintain digital tools and databases consolidating operational information for the department.
- Manage errand requests, general provisioning (intendance) and administrative filing.
- Coordinate guest-related show information with the VIP team using digitalised supports.
Qualifications
- Enrolled in a university or school with a mandatory internship agreement (convention de stage).
- Strong proficiency in Microsoft Office; familiarity with administrative or order-management systems (Dior Order preferred).
- Professional command of English; practical knowledge of Italian is a plus.
- High level of discretion and respect for confidentiality when handling sensitive information.
- Rigorous, well organised, proactive and able to anticipate needs in a fast-paced creative environment.
- Availability, adaptability and willingness to work full-time during a six-month internship (start in September).
